Often called a prequel to PETER PAN, it's the story of one girl, Molly, the daughter of an illustrious “starcatcher” who ventures to save the world from the devious Black Stache and his fellow swashbuckling pirates! As she sails the oceans on a ship called The Neverland, Molly, alongside an orphan simply named “boy,” must find and protect a mysterious chest that contains enough magic to transform the world. On this enchanted and whimsical adventure story, audiences will learn about friendship, loyalty, love and how a certain orphan becomes the mythical “boy who wouldn’t grow up.” This imaginative production took New York by storm and garnered five Tony Awards (2012) and a Drama Desk Award. It's written by Rick Elice with music by Wayne Barker and is based on the novel by Dave Barry and Ridley Pearson.
